Navigating Colonial Legacies

This chapter offers a comprehensive analysis of colonialism from its ancient roots to its modern implications, particularly in settler colonial contexts. It critically examines the myth of the 'beautiful people' in pre-colonial societies while emphasizing indigenous contributions to environmental management. Additionally, the chapter reflects on the complexities of identity and historical narratives, challenging oversimplified views of conflict and advocating for coexistence amidst deeply entrenched hostilities.
